Leslie Deere is a UK based audio visual artist. Originally from Tennessee, Leslie moved to study Sonic Art in the UK, continuing on from a dance scholarship in New York City. She holds a BA Honours degree in Sonic Art under Hugh Davies at Middlesex University and an MA in Communication Art & Design from the Royal College of Art - Acoustic Images pathway (Jon Wozencroft, Touch Recs).

Commissions include sound installations for Kew Gardens, London and New York Fashion Weeks. Her work has been featured on The Late Junction - BBC Radio 3, Freak Zone - Radio 6, Resonance FM, NTS and Radio Concertzender. In 2015-2016 Leslie was selected for the Sound and Music Organisation’s Embedded Residency at Music Hackspace in London and was commissioned by the 2016 Whitstable Biennale to debut the new Kinect performance work, Modern Conjuring for Amateurs.

In late 2017 Leslie began PhD research at the Glasgow School of Art, with a focus on altered states, sound, interactive and gesture based technologies. Most recently Deere took part in the 2018 Forthwith experimental music and arts Festival in Winnipeg, Canada and released a new book featuring Southern US artists, entitled Twisted Scripture.

Graham Dunning is self-taught as an artist and musician having studied neither discipline academically. His live work explores sound as texture, timbre and something tactile, drawing on bedroom production, tinkering and recycling found objects. He also creates visual work, video and installations drawing on these themes.
Much of the work evolves through experimentation with different processes: considering the methods by which sounds become music; process as a continuum encompassing both improvisational and procedural methods; and testing analogous processes across different media.
Graham has performed solo and in ensembles across the UK, Europe and Canada, and exhibited in the UK, Europe, New Zealand and USA. He teaches Experimental Sound Art at the Mary Ward Centre in London and also gives various independent workshops. He has released through Entr’acte, Seagrave, Tombed Visions and more.
